The Dark Side of Positive Psychology
During the pandemic, as a psychologist in a nursing home, I witnessed suffering and loss up close. This experience made me even more critical of so-called "positive psychology," which seems to ignore the complexities of life and promote a superficial, unrealistic happiness.
Manipulation in the Digital Age
I am also concerned about the manipulation seen on LinkedIn and other social networks, especially towards vulnerable people. I believe it is important to cultivate critical thinking to avoid falling into the traps of gurus and scammers.
